## Tuning

Bucketloom assigns variants via consistent hashing with a sticky cache in front. Defaults favor assignment stability over memory. If eviction churn exceeds 2%/min, raise the cache ceiling before touching hash salt rotation. Salt rotation invalidates every open experiment, so treat it as a last resort. Current defaults are as follows.

tuning table, kahop-fahog:
RATE_LIMITS = {
    "wenix": 1,
    "druael": 10,
    "holix": 1,
    "zorael": 1,
}

- [ ] Step 7: Archive cold storage buckets (Glacierline tier). Confirm both ceremony witnesses are present, verify bucket manifests match the Oxbow ledger, then seal the archive key shares. Plugin authors may observe but not handle shares. Once sealed, the archive index itself is encrypted and can only be reopened with the passphrase below.

vault phrase of badup-hahig = tamael-aldael-kelmir-istael-fenok-istwyn-tamius-jorath-oliion

Subject: Quickstore 4.2 — bloom filter now fronts the KV layer

Plugin authors: starting with this release, Quickstore places a bloom filter ahead of the key-value store. Negative lookups return faster; false positives fall through safely. No API changes are required on your side. Verify your plugin against the staging build referenced below.

session token of fahif-tadup = htk3_9c7